The Current State of Manchester Unitedโs Ownership
Manchester United has been under the ownership of the Glazer family since 2005, a tenure characterized by both sporting success and financial controversy. During their time, the club has enjoyed considerable achievements, securing five Premier League titles and a UEFA Champions League trophy. However, the Glazers have faced persistent criticism over the club’s financial strategies, particularly concerning the debt incurred by their leveraged buyout and the perceived lack of reinvestment in the clubโs infrastructure.

Market and Financial Implications
The potential sale of Manchester United is a significant event not only within the realm of sports but also in the broader financial landscape. With Forbes valuing the club at approximately $4.6 billion, Manchester United ranks among the most valuable sports franchises globally. This potential sale could set a new benchmark for the valuation of football clubs, influencing future deals and investor interest across the Premier League and other major leagues.
